Cricket: Vaughan irked by Cup uncertainty

New Zealand Cricket Chief Justin Vaughan supports the idea of ten-team 2015 World Cup format.

WELLINGTON:
New Zealand Cricket Chief Justin Vaughan supports the idea of ten-team 2015 World Cup format while urging the International Cricket Council (ICC) should finally reach a swift decision on the terms according to which sides will qualify.


“As the hosts of that competition, it is unhelpful to have renewed uncertainty over the format,” said Vaughan. Criticism over the initial exclusion of Associate nations in favour of the game’s ten Full Member countries prompted the ICC Executive Board to reconsider the decision. ICC President Sharad Pawar announced that a renewed discussion of the qualification process will take place in June.
